Also: anyone have any clue what Miami-Dade wants with their non-OCI form? When they are asking for "externship" experience under FL Rule 11, do they mean any summer employment whatsoever? Or only summer employment where you appeared on the record in court?
Rule 11 provides for working as a Certified Legal Intern pre-bar. You must have taken a clinic or externship
for credit, so summer employment won't count. Also you have to have been representing a client or the state (not necessarily appearing in court though).

Anonymous User wrote:I cant tell if Kings County hires pre bar or not
Each year over 2,500 graduates from law schools representing all regions across the nation apply for a limited number of positions. At this time, we only hire graduates after they have passed the New York State Bar Examination. New classes of Assistant District Attorneys begin in January.
They do. If you are the Class of 2014, you apply starting Sept. 1, 2013. As I understand it, you start Jan. 2015. That's a six-month post-bar time-frame because apparently NY bar results for the August test come back in Jan.
So:
1. Apply Sept 2013.
2. Interview etc. through end of 2013.
3. Take August 2014 bar.
4. Pass? Get results in Jan 2015.
5. Begin at KCDA Jan. 2015.
I think, THINK, that's how it works. I talked to an alumna from my law school who was in Step Three of this process, and she will start Jan 2014.

Anonymous User wrote:Anonymous User wrote:Is anyone applying to Colorado or is that just the PD that hires recent grads?
its just the PD office
I know a few people who got hired into full-time jobs with various Colorado DAs' offices after getting bar results back. However, they all interned there during law school (and at least one worked for the DA for free between taking the bar and getting results back). Also, keep in mind there isn't a central DA the way there's a centralized PD, so you'd have to go through each county's DA office.
